Stardust is a cosmic stereo tape looper designed to capture and manipulate layers of sound with high fidelity and seamless looping. Record, overdub, and transform audio with controls for wow & flutter, tape hiss, and other DSP effects, creating warm, nostalgic textures or experimental sounds. With 10 minutes of mono or 5 minutes of stereo looping, save and recall recordings, or import and export audio via USB. Stardust is built on the Daisy platform, enabling updates and firmware customisation.

Key Features:

  • High-Fidelity Audio:
    Capture pristine sound with 48kHz, 32-bit processing, 24-bit hardware, and an ultra-low noise floor.
  • Vintage Tape Effects:
    Add wow & flutter, tape hiss, reverb, and vintage saturation for analogue warmth and experimental vibes.
  • Convenient Storage:
    Save, recall, export, or import recordings via USB; configure settings through the Narwhal web editor.

Specifications:

  • Maximum Loop Time: 10 minutes mono, 5 minutes stereo
  • Audio Quality: 48kHz, 32-bit internal processing, 24-bit hardware
  • USB Compatibility: USB drive for save/load functions

Looper pedals record short sections of your playing and repeat them, allowing you to build layers, practise solos, create backing parts or perform complete arrangements on your own. They are useful for songwriting, live performance and developing timing and improvisation skills.

Simple loopers are great for practice and quick ideas, while advanced models may include multiple tracks, memory slots, rhythm patterns and stereo operation. A looper can become a creative tool in its own right, helping you hear your playing in context and build songs from the ground up.
